The Third Edition of Molecular Biology: Genes to Proteins is a comprehensive guide through
the basic molecular processes and genetic phenomena of both prokaryotic and eukaryotic cells.
Designed for undergraduate and fi rst year graduate students, this multi-purpose text has been
completely updated to include many important advances made in the fi eld of molecular biology.
Maintaining the original structure-function approach evident in the fi rst two editions of David
Freifelder's classic text, this book provides students with an accessible overview of molecular
biology before moving into more in-depth discussions. Broken into six sections, topics are
strategically arranged to cover basic information that is necessary in understanding the more
advanced topics focused on in later sections.
SECTION STRUCTURE
Section 1 and 2: Protein Structure and Function and Nucleic Acids and Nucleoproteins provide
the information required to understand the chemical basis of molecular biology.
Section 3: Genetics and Virology provides information required to understand the biological basis
of molecular biology.
Section 4: DNA Metabolism explores DNA replication, repair, and recombination in bacteria,
eukaryotes and archaeons.
Section 5: RNA Synthesis and Processing examines mechanisms that bacteria, eukaryotes,
and archaeons use to synthesize RNA, regulate RNA syntheses, and process transcripts to form
mature RNA molecules.
Section 6: Protein Synthesis describes the structure and function of the bacterial protein
synthetic machinery in bacteria, eukaryotes and archaeons.Table of Contents
